Hit the jackpot

verb

Definitions

Verb
  1. 1
    To receive a more favorable outcome than imagined, especially by good luck. idiomatic

    "Before 1914, coal was a true cash-cow, and on paper, the GWR looked to have hit the jackpot by being handed all the railways in the South Wales coal fields."

  2. 2
    succeed by luck wordnet
  3. 3
    To be accurate or correct. idiomatic
  4. 4
    Used other than figuratively or idiomatically: see hit, jackpot.
